FIBER

I can hand and garment sew, embroider, knit, crochet, weave and spin.

Favorite Fabrics: Cotton (retro prints imported from Japan, Liberty), 100% wool felt

I do nearly all my machine sewing on a Bernina 240, but I also have a working Featherweight and 301 that I use occasionally. Would love to sew on a treadle. I have a collection of sewing machines that I have stopped adding to; the vintage mini toy ones are my favorite because they are easy to display on a bookshelf.

I have 2 Ashford spinning wheels, a single and double drive – I am a novice. I make ugly yarn. Hate "wasting" roving to make ugly yarn; therefore, never going to get better because I don't practice.

Some sewing likes: Costumery, vintage sewing stuff (patterns, notions, buttons, equipment, literature, advertising, tools, furniture), friendship bracelets, modern macramé, visible mending, make do and mend, Boho Embroidery, Zakka, Sashiko.
